They did have a ton of injuries this season. Stewart and Jones each missed 13 games. Sabally missed half the season. Ionescu was hurt at the end of the season. Harrison missed nine games.

The starting five at the beginning of the season only played 11 games together, none from July 27-Sept. 10.

All of that is fair, but a lot of teams dealt with injuries with far less talent. The Fever is in the second round of the playoff with six players out for the season.

By the time the playoffs hit the Liberty had essentially their full roster and were wildly outclassed by the Mercury, which really shouldn't happen. The Liberty showed no effort at all and Brondello doesn't make adjustments. It was a terrible look.
